The real reason for infertility caused by uterine fibroids

In fact, Xiao Chen's concerns are unnecessary. According to medical statistics, most patients with uterine fibroids do not have their fertility affected, and uterine fibroids are definitely not a common cause of infertility.

Infertile patients with uterine fibroids often have other real reasons, such as obstructed fallopian tubes, ovulation disorders, etc.

Infertility caused by uterine fibroids is mainly seen in submucosal fibroids. Other fibroids that do not exceed 5 cm, especially those growing between the uterine muscle walls, will neither affect menstruation nor pregnancy, and do not even need to be removed.

Even if uterine fibroids require surgical treatment, you can consider pregnancy after one year of contraception after surgery. This is because the uterus will basically recover six months after surgery, ensuring that it will not rupture during pregnancy.

Not only that, for women of childbearing age who are diagnosed with uterine fibroids and plan to have children, doctors will recommend that they get pregnant early. This is not because they are afraid that they will not be able to have a baby if it is too late, but because pregnancy itself has a therapeutic effect on the disease.

Since the growth of fibroids is related to the levels of estrogen and progesterone in the body, larger fibroids lack effective estrogen receptors inside, which reduces the effect of estrogen. Therefore, some larger fibroids can remain unchanged or even shrink during pregnancy.

How to choose the treatment for uterine fibroids?

Of course, if a woman wants to prepare for pregnancy after surgery, she needs to carefully choose "endometrial ablation" and "uterine artery embolization" when choosing the treatment for uterine fibroids.

Because the former will insert a thin catheter into the uterus through the vagina and cervix, and achieve the purpose of treating fibroids by slightly "destroying" the uterine lining. However, this damage will also affect the subsequent pregnancy and fertility of the uterus.

The latter involves pushing a thin catheter into the uterus through the leg artery, and then using plastic beads to block the arteries that supply blood to the fibroids to shrink the fibroids. However, at the same time, the local blood supply to the uterus is also blocked, which is not conducive to future pregnancy and childbirth.

Therefore, these two minimally invasive treatments are generally only used for women who have given birth and do not plan to have more children. For women who plan to have children, ultrasonic ablation can be considered. On the one hand, it can increase the chance of pregnancy by improving the uterine pregnancy environment, and it can also avoid the corresponding complications caused by the growth of uterine fibroids during pregnancy.

It is recommended to arrange pregnancy 3 months after ultrasound ablation based on the recovery of the uterus. Generally, within 3-6 months after ablation, the fibroids are rapidly absorbed and reduced, the sterile inflammation after ablation also subsides, and the uterus recovers quickly, which is conducive to pregnancy.
